Cool Noob saying hi, project to start... suggestions welcome

Hello,

I've bee reading the forums for a little over a year now and finally took the big step into doing my own system.

I have a '99 Navy Blue Corvette Convertable. I want the instal to be stealth and oem looking so i will be molding a xenarc screen in the dash and building a custom case in the rear stoarage compartment.

Here is what I have so far:
Mach Speed Micro-ATX mobo
Xenarc 7" touchscreen vga w/ vid input
old 15 gig 3.5 inch hd (will upgrade later)
sound blaster 5.1 live soundcard
Phoenix Gold Titanium 4x75w stable to 1 ohm

Here is what I will be getting in the comming week:
opus 150 watt p/s
JL audio 2 way components
pioneer premier 12 sub
wide ange reverse camera installed in the third brake light
sprint pcs cell phone for web access.
slot drive dvd player mounted below the monitor?

So I need to figure out what amd xp proc I need and the ram that will go with the mobo as well as what gps mouse/antenna that I'll need.

I was thinking about 256 mb of ram for now, It seems like this will be fine for my application.


So any Ideas suggestions comments would be welcome and greatly appreciated.

Eh, sounds good so far. Nice choice with the machspeed board. I can't believe those guys offer a lifetime warranty... hope you filled out your registration card. Anyway, these boards are made by a Tawainese company named Jetway, the same as my board manufacturer. Good choice. I love those guys.

As far as your processor goes, what model of motherboard do you have??
